Transaction de437a9f8e82054aa0cc32912fa7bd8a301c20e760178bf440bd519b49cdef75
1 Input
1 Outputs
- de437a9f8e82054aa0cc32912fa7bd8a301c20e760178bf440bd519b49cdef75:0
value 3503685
address 39WtXTwfAbkeEFAHDfXeHDSkTtAGHpdSJP